Steel roof in Washington

For residents in Washington, especially within the dynamic urban landscape of Seattle, selecting a roofing system that effectively combats the region's persistent precipitation and moisture is paramount. The state's climate, characterized by prolonged periods of rain, overcast skies, and moderate temperatures, places significant demands on roofing materials, necessitating robust solutions that prevent water intrusion and resist the corrosive effects of damp environments.

The typical housing stock in Washington, including the greater Seattle area, often features asphalt shingles, wood shakes, and increasingly, metal roofing. Steel roofing, particularly standing seam profiles with concealed fasteners and high-performance coatings like Kynar 500, presents a superior option for this climate. Its inherent water shedding capabilities, coupled with resistance to moss and algae growth common in damp conditions, make it an exceptionally durable choice. The installation methodology is critical, emphasizing proper underlayment, ventilation, and the precise integration of flashing at all penetrations and valleys to prevent the ingress of moisture, which can lead to structural damage and mold proliferation.

Can you repair just a section of a steel roof in Washington?

Yes, it is generally possible to repair a localized section of a steel roof in Washington, provided the damage is not extensive. A skilled contractor will assess the affected area, determining if replacing individual panels or performing seam repairs is a suitable solution, thereby preserving the overall integrity and performance of the roofing system against regional weather patterns.

Does a 20-year-old steel roof need to be replaced in Washington?

The necessity of replacing a 20-year-old steel roof in Washington hinges on its condition, the quality of the original installation, and the specific environmental stresses it has endured. A professional inspection will evaluate the integrity of the roof's components, including fasteners and coatings, to ascertain if repairs are sufficient or if a replacement is advisable to prevent water intrusion.
